CASES TYPE OF CASE DETAILS OF THE CASE PROGRESS REPORT ON THE CASE1. Case No:
696/2010
Nephawe Netshidzi-welele
VS
The President of SA and Others Ref No: 1/4/69
Civil 2010 Mr Nephawe brought an application in the Venda High Court interdicting the President of the Republic of South Africa from recognizing Mr. Toni MphephuRamabulane as a King
The matter was heard on 13-16 August 2012 at Thohoyandou High Court.
Judgment was handed down on 6 September 2012. The application was dismissed with costs.
���������� ����� �������� ����intention to appeal to the Supreme Court of Appeal on 21 September 2012. The application was dismissed with costs.
Furthermore, Application for leave to appeal Rule 49(11) was dismissed with costs on the 24 June 2013.
������������� ������������ �����interdict application against the President and 6 others. The application is being opposed at Supreme Court of Appeal by the Commission.
2. Case No.: 40404/2008
Bapedi Marota Mamone
VS
The President of SA and Others
Ref No.: 1/4/39
Civil 2008 Kgoshi Mampuru brought an application in the High Court seeking the review and setting aside the decision of the Commission and the President of recognising Mr. Victor Thulare as the King of Bapedi.
The matter was heard on 12 September 2012.
Judgment was handed down on 21 September 2012. Application was dismissed with costs.
�� ������������ ������� �� ������ ���and it was dismissed with costs on 22 November 2012
Applicants have advised that they intend appealing to the Supreme Court of Appeal.

CASES TYPE OF CASE DETAILS OF THE CASE PROGRESS REPORT ON THE CASE3. Case No.: 68501/10
Justice Mpondombini Sigcau
VS
The President of SA and Others
Ref No.: 1/4/72
Civil 2010 The late King Justice MpondombiniSigcau brought an application in the High Court seeking the review and setting aside the decision of the Commission of recognising TyelovuyoSigcau as a King.
The matter was set down for hearing on 22-23 February 2012.
The matter was heard on both days and on 12 April 2012 judgment was handed down where Applicant’s application was dismissed with costs.
On 21 May 2012 an application for leave to Appeal was heard and dismissed.
Applicant petitioned the Supreme Court of Appeal (SCA) in Bloemfontein.
On 16 August 2012 the Supreme Court of Appeal dismissed the Applicant’s application with costs.
�� �������������� ���� ������� �����to appeal to the Constitutional Court.
We instructed our Counsels to oppose the said application and to prepare the ����������������
The matter was down for hearing at the Constitutional Court on 21 February 2013.
Judgment was passed in favour of appellants in that the First Respondent ought to have used the old act.
Opinion on the implications of judgment was obtained from AdvArendse SC, Adv D Borgstrom JC and AdvLupuwana JC. Further engagements with regard to the interpretation of judgment are underway.

15. Case No.: 773/12
Masindi Clementine Mphephu
VS
Regent Toni Mphep-hu- Ramabulana & Others
Ref No.:
Civil 2012 Mr.MasindiMphephu brought an application to the High Court for an order amongst others in the following terms-
a) Declaring that the Second Respondent’s decision dated 14 September 2012 to recognise the First Respondent as a King of Vhavenda community is unconstitutional and invalid;
b) Reviewing and setting aside the decision referred to in paragraph 1 above;
c) Declaring the rule of male primogeniture as it applies in customary law to the succession to the position of traditional leader as in inconsistent with the Constitution and invalid to the extent that it precludes women from succeeding to the position of a traditional leader;
d) Declaring that the word “progressively” in the Preamble and in sections 2(3)(c), and 2B(4)(c) of the Traditional Leadership and Governance Framework Act No. 41 of 2003 is inconsistent with the Constitution and invalid;
e) Declaring that in terms of customary law-
�� ���������������� ��� �@� ������ �Q��� ����@� ����%��� ����� ���� � ������ ����� ���� �sole King of the Vhavenda Kingship; and
f) Substituting for the President’s decision referred to in paragraph 1, a decision that –
�� �=��������������� ����� ����� ��� �@� ������ �Q��� ����@� �������� ����� ���� �& �����Applicant is recognised as the sole King of the Vhavenda in terms of the Traditional Leadership Act.
